Understanding Dog Cologne: What It Is and Why It Matters

Definition and Purpose

Dog cologne is a specially formulated fragrance designed to keep your pet smelling fresh between baths. Unlike human colognes, dog colognes are made with pet-safe ingredients that won't irritate your dog's skin or coat. The primary purpose of dog cologne is to neutralize odors and provide a pleasant scent that both pets and their owners can enjoy.

Benefits for Your Pet

Using dog cologne offers several benefits:

  • Odor Control: Helps to neutralize and eliminate unpleasant smells.
  • Enhanced Grooming: Complements regular grooming routines, making your pet look and smell their best.
  • Comfort: Some scents can have a calming effect on dogs, reducing anxiety and stress.

Common Ingredients

Dog colognes typically contain a blend of water, essential oils, and other pet-safe ingredients. Here are some common components:

  • Aloe Vera: Known for its soothing properties.
  • Chamomile: Often included for its calming effects.
  • Lavender Oil: Provides a pleasant scent and has natural antibacterial properties.
When choosing a dog cologne, always check the ingredient list to ensure it contains only pet-safe components. Avoid products with alcohol or artificial fragrances, as these can be harmful to your pet.

Addressing Common Concerns About Dog Cologne

Potential Allergies

When introducing any new product to your pet, it's crucial to be aware of potential allergies. Always perform a patch test before applying dog cologne extensively. Apply a small amount to a less sensitive area and monitor for any adverse reactions. Common signs of allergies include itching, redness, and swelling. If you notice any of these symptoms, discontinue use immediately and consult your veterinarian.

Routine Scheduling

Establishing a consistent grooming schedule is crucial for maintaining your dog's health and hygiene. Aim to bathe your dog every 4-6 weeks, depending on their breed and activity level. In between baths, use dog cologne to keep your pet smelling fresh. Regular grooming sessions also provide an opportunity to check for any signs of health issues.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is dog cologne and why should I use it?

Dog cologne is a specially formulated fragrance designed for pets. It helps keep your dog smelling fresh between baths and can enhance their overall grooming routine.

Are the ingredients in dog cologne safe for my pet?

Most dog colognes are made with pet-safe ingredients, but it's always best to check the label for any potential allergens and consult with your veterinarian if you have concerns.

How often should I apply dog cologne to my pet?

The frequency of application can vary depending on the product and your dog's needs. Generally, it's recommended to use dog cologne once a week or as needed to maintain freshness.

Can dog cologne cause allergies in pets?

While most dog colognes are formulated to be hypoallergenic, some pets may still have sensitivities. It's important to do a patch test before full application and monitor your pet for any adverse reactions.

Is it safe to use dog cologne on puppies?

It's best to consult with your veterinarian before using any grooming products on puppies. Some colognes may be too strong for young dogs, so it's important to choose a product specifically designed for puppies.

What should I do if my dog has a reaction to the cologne?

If your dog shows signs of an allergic reaction, such as itching, redness, or swelling, discontinue use immediately and consult your veterinarian for advice.
